Position Overview: 

  • Lead the psycho-educational assessment process for PreK-8th grade students, including administering and interpreting cognitive, academic, and social-emotional measures for eligibility determination.
  • Provide consultation and tiered intervention support (MTSS/RtI) to staff, parents, and students to ensure access to appropriate school-based and community resources.

Qualifications:

  • Master's Degree 
  • Valid Illinois School Psychologist Certification
  • Illinois Professional Educator License (PEL) with a School Psychologist Endorsement
  • Prior experience providing psychological services in a school setting (Preferred)
